What Are Freestyle Type Beats?

To be aware of the significance of freestyle trap beats, it's vital to first break down what a freestyle beat actually is. In easy terms, a freestyle beat is an instrumental track that is developed for artists to rap or sing over without the requirement for pre-written lyrics or melodies. It's indicated to influence off-the-cuff efficiencies, motivating rap artists to provide spontaneous and often much more raw, heated verses.

A freestyle type beat varies somewhat from a routine instrumental in that it's structured in a way that gives musicians area to take a breath. These beats commonly have fewer melodic elements, leaving room for detailed circulations and powerful wordplay. They're also typically more recurring than standard tune instrumentals, making sure that the rap artist or singer can conveniently discover their groove and ride the beat without getting shed in complicated setups.

Freestyle Trap Beats A Subgenre Within Freestyle

Currently, within the realm of freestyle beats, there is a details subset called freestyle trap beat. Trap music, stemming from the southern USA, is defined by heavy use 808 bass drums, fast hi-hat patterns, and dark, moody tunes. It's a sound that has grown in popularity throughout the years, becoming one of the most significant categories in modern-day rap.

Freestyle trap beats take these signature aspects and fuse them with the flexibility and flexibility of freestyle beats, leading to a potent mixture. These beats are excellent for artists seeking to bring power and aggression to their verses while still preserving the flexibility to discover various circulations and designs.

What Is a Free Type Beat?

A free type beat is an instrumental that producers give free of cost use, typically for non-commercial purposes. While the beats can be made use of for trials, freestyles, and social media web content, musicians usually require to invest a certificate if they want to release the tune commercially (i.e., on streaming platforms or available for sale).

This version has actually been a game-changer, permitting young musicians to explore their sound, exercise their freestyling, and develop an web-based presence without needing to worry about manufacturing prices.

How to Find the Perfect Freestyle Trap Beat.

With numerous options available, finding the best freestyle trap freestyle beat trap beat can really feel difficult. Right here are some essential aspects to think about when searching for the perfect beat:.

1. The Bpm (Beats per Minute)

The speed of a beat will figure out the overall feeling of your freestyle. Freestyle type beats with rapid paces are optimal for high-energy performances, while slower tempos provide you more area to discover various circulations and lyrical styles. Consider your style and exactly how comfy you are freestyling at various rates before choosing a beat.

2. Complexity.

Some beats are a lot more elaborate than others, including a wide selection of sounds, melodies, and transitions. While complicated beats can add enjoyment to a track, they could also make it tougher to freestyle over. Easier freestyle beats are typically much easier to work with, as they offer a empty canvas for your lyrics.

3. Atmosphere and Atmosphere.

The spirit of the beat really should match the message or power you wish to share. Freestyle trap beats frequently have dark, moody atmospheres, yet there are also more uplifting or melodic choices readily available. Pay attention to a range of beats and choose one that reverberates with your artistic vision.

4. Knowledge with the Sound.

Particular kinds of beats, like the DaBaby type beat, are created to cater to specific circulations and rap designs. If you fit rapping over fast, hard-hitting instrumentals, this may be the very best alternative for you. Nonetheless, if you favor a even more easygoing mode, look for a totally free type beat or freestyle beat with a slower, more loosened up atmosphere.
